# Clock skew handling for Forgeline build agents.
# Support: when customers report "build finished before it started,"
# it's skew between agents, not corruption. The scheduler tolerates
# drift up to a threshold, warns in a middle band, and quarantines
# agents beyond it. Do not raise limits to silence tickets; fix NTP
# on the agent instead. Thresholds are defined below.

limits module of haweg-badug:
RATE_LIMITS = {
    "casox": 339,
    "wenix": 653,
    "rusok": 650,
    "lamix": 337,
    "aldvan": 753,
}

Subject: FY Headcount Plan — Draft for Review

Department heads: attached is the draft headcount plan for Calderwyn Systems next fiscal year. Net growth is capped at 4%, weighted toward the Thornmere engineering hub. Please validate your role requests against the budget envelope by Tuesday. One confidential item follows for this distribution only.

board note of fahap-yafop: Headcount on the Istion team goes from 50 to 73 by the end of September. Gross margin on Istion came in at 33 percent against a plan of 28 percent.

Subject: Invoice renderer cut-over summary

Hi Jonsa,

We completed the cut-over of the Quillform PDF invoice renderer to the new Ashvale cluster at 23:15. All pending render jobs drained from the old queue first, and the first 500 invoices on the new stack passed visual diff checks. Font embedding and pagination match the legacy output. The old renderer stays in read-only mode until Friday. For your records, the service now runs with the following configuration values.

service settings:
quenath:
  log_level: info
  metrics_host: metrics.quenath.tolvaqlabs.internal
  pin: 1407
  pool_size: 8

**Ticket: Nested blockquotes break table rendering in Inkhollow**

New folks: the Inkhollow markdown pipeline mangles tables inside nested blockquotes — cells collapse into one column. Repro: any doc with a two-level quote plus a table. Parser stage, not the renderer. Fix likely in the block tokenizer. First bad version traces to this build.

build token for bafof-tafof: htk14_89de060c9a03ad